"IT IS WRITTEN..."


As we  get this new year rolling, I felt a stirring in my spirit in the form of a warning. Christians know that their enemy the devil prowls around like a roaring lion looking for someone to devour. (1 Peter 5:8) That "The Thief", another name for our enemy, comes only to steal, kill, and destroy. (John 10:10) A good example of how Satan tries to do this is found in the account of the Temptation of Christ - Matthew 4:1-11.

Temptation has at it's core doubt in something or someone. The challenge to turn the stones into bread doubted God's Provision. The dare to jump from the top of the Temple doubted God's Protection. The invitation to worship Satan for all the earthly kingdoms doubted God's Promises about the Christ. In addition, all of the tempting was targeted at two vulnerable points - (1) when Christ was alone and (2) at Christ's supposed weaknesses.

The Spirit led Jesus into the wilderness to experience these temptations, and possibly other trials during His forty day fast, on our behalf. However, the answer always was the same - "It is written....". The Word of God, which was Himself in the flesh, now physically responds to each temptation by declaring the truth of the matter.

It is a good thing to sure-up the areas in our life we know are weak and guard to the best of our ability, with God's help, against temptation. However, I encourage you and me this year, should we find ourselves alone and our weak points being targeted with temptations by the enemy - the answer is always the same and always available - research it, read it, and recite it. Whatever "it" is, the start of resisting the devil and seeing him flee is - "It Is Written...".
